  • OP, 6 meals a day is a good suggestion if you are the type of person who is hungry all the time. Keeps you from over eating, consuming correct amount of calories per day. It does not speed up your metabolism (people will tell you this), or any healthier for you to eat 6 compared to 3. If you are happy with 3 meals a day,…

  • A chest cold is different than head cold. Bronchitis can become serious if you are in the mist of it, you don't want to be coughing mucas for months if it does. I've always been told that if you are sick below the neck stay home. Exercise raises your body tempature so if you have any kind of fever it will become worse. You…
